WebJun 8, 2024 · Figure 45.2 B. 1: Exponential and logistical population growth: When resources are unlimited, populations exhibit exponential growth, resulting in a J-shaped curve. When resources are limited, populations exhibit logistic growth. In logistic growth, population expansion decreases as resources become scarce, leveling off when the …

The exponential growth equation is a realistic description of the growth ... theatres downtown pittsburghWebIn the logistic growth model, the population experiences a leveling off of exponential growth due to limiting resources. In turn, the shape of the graph, which was formerly a J-shaped curve , now shifts to an S-shaped curve on a graph that models population growth. the grand tour scandi flick torrent
